иерархия компьютера: структура и принципы работы
В глубинах каждого устройства, которое мы используем каждый день, скрывается сложная система, управляющая всеми его действиями. Эта система, подобно организму, состоит из множества взаимосвязанных компонентов, каждый из которых выполняет свою уникальную функцию. В этой статье мы рассмотрим, как эти компоненты объединены в единое целое, обеспечивая бесперебойную работу техники, которой мы доверяем свою жизнь.
Начнем с самого верха, где находится мозг всей системы – центральный процессор. Этот компонент, часто называемый сердцем устройства, отвечает за выполнение команд и обработку данных. Однако, чтобы процессор мог эффективно выполнять свои задачи, ему необходимы помощники. Одним из таких помощников является оперативная память, которая временно хранит данные, необходимые для работы в текущий момент. Без нее процессор был бы вынужден постоянно обращаться к более медленным источникам информации, что значительно снизило бы скорость работы всей системы.
Далее, спускаясь вглубь, мы встретимся с постоянным хранилищем данных, таким как жесткий диск или твердотельный накопитель. Эти компоненты, в отличие от оперативной памяти, хранят информацию надолго, даже после выключения устройства. Они выполняют роль архивов, где сохраняются все важные данные, от документов до программ и игр. Без этих хранилищ наша техника была бы лишена возможности сохранять прогресс и возвращаться к нему в любой момент.
Основные компоненты компьютерной иерархии
В современном мире вычислительные устройства состоят из множества элементов, каждый из которых выполняет свою уникальную функцию. Эти элементы взаимодействуют друг с другом, образуя сложную систему, способную выполнять широкий спектр задач. Рассмотрим ключевые составляющие, которые обеспечивают функционирование этой системы.
На самом верхнем уровне находится процессор, который является сердцем вычислительного устройства. Он отвечает за выполнение команд и обработку данных. Взаимодействие процессора с другими компонентами происходит через шину данных, которая обеспечивает передачу информации между различными частями системы.
Память играет важную роль в хранении данных и программ, необходимых для работы устройства. Она делится на оперативную и постоянную. Оперативная память (RAM) обеспечивает быстрый доступ к данным во время выполнения задач, в то время как постоянная память (например, жесткий диск или SSD) используется для долгосрочного хранения информации.
Вводные устройства, такие как клавиатура и мышь, позволяют пользователю взаимодействовать с системой. Они преобразуют действия пользователя в электрические сигналы, которые затем обрабатываются процессором.
Все эти компоненты работают в тесном взаимодействии, обеспечивая эффективное функционирование вычислительного устройства.
Центральный процессор: мозг компьютера
В основе любой вычислительной системы лежит компонент, отвечающий за обработку информации и выполнение команд. Этот компонент, известный как центральный процессор, выполняет функции, аналогичные мозгу человека, управляя всеми операциями и обеспечивая их бесперебойную работу.
Ключевая роль ЦП заключается в выполнении арифметических и логических операций, а также в управлении потоком данных между различными компонентами системы. Этот компонент постоянно находится в режиме ожидания, готовый к выполнению следующей команды. Скорость и эффективность работы ЦП напрямую влияют на общую производительность системы.
Современные процессоры оснащены множеством технологий, направленных на повышение производительности и снижение энергопотребления. Ключевыми характеристиками являются тактовая частота, количество ядер и архитектура. Чем выше тактовая частота, тем быстрее процессор выполняет команды. Множество ядер позволяет параллельно обрабатывать больше задач, что особенно важно для многозадачных операционных систем.
Память: оперативная и постоянная
В любой вычислительной системе память играет ключевую роль, обеспечивая хранение данных и инструкций, необходимых для выполнения задач. Существуют два основных типа памяти, каждый из которых выполняет свою уникальную функцию и обладает своими особенностями.
Оперативная память, также известная как ОЗУ (оперативное запоминающее устройство), обеспечивает быстрый доступ к данным, которые активно используются в текущий момент. Этот тип памяти является временным хранилищем, и его содержимое теряется при отключении питания. ОЗУ позволяет процессору быстро получать доступ к необходимым данным, что значительно ускоряет выполнение задач.
В отличие от оперативной памяти, постоянная память предназначена для долговременного хранения данных. Этот тип памяти сохраняет информацию даже после отключения питания. Примерами постоянных запоминающих устройств являются жесткие диски, твердотельные накопители (SSD) и оптические диски. Постоянная память используется для хранения операционных систем, программ и пользовательских данных, обеспечивая их доступность при каждом включении устройства.
Взаимодействие оперативной и постоянной памяти позволяет системе эффективно управлять данными, обеспечивая быстрый доступ к текущим задачам и надежное хранение информации на длительный срок.
Функционирование компьютерной системы
В основе любой компьютерной системы лежит взаимодействие различных компонентов, каждый из которых выполняет свою специфическую задачу. Эти компоненты организованы таким образом, чтобы обеспечить максимальную эффективность и производительность. Рассмотрим ключевые аспекты, которые определяют, как эти элементы взаимодействуют друг с другом.
- Уровни обработки данных: Компьютерная система состоит из нескольких уровней, каждый из которых отвечает за определенный этап обработки информации. На самом низком уровне находятся аппаратные компоненты, такие как процессор и память. Выше располагаются системные программы, которые управляют этими компонентами. На вершине находятся прикладные программы, которые непосредственно взаимодействуют с пользователем.
- Порядок выполнения задач: Каждая задача, выполняемая компьютером, проходит через определенную последовательность этапов. Сначала она поступает на обработку в центральный процессор, затем данные передаются в оперативную память для временного хранения, после чего результаты могут быть сохранены на жестком диске или переданы обратно пользователю. Этот порядок обеспечивает логическую последовательность и эффективность выполнения задач.
- Взаимодействие компонентов: Компоненты компьютерной системы взаимодействуют друг с другом через специальные интерфейсы и протоколы. Например, процессор обменивается данными с оперативной памятью через шину данных, а жесткий диск передает информацию через контроллер. Это взаимодействие обеспечивает бесперебойную работу всей системы.
- Управление ресурсами: Компьютерная система должна эффективно управлять своими ресурсами, такими как процессорное время, память и дисковое пространство. Для этого используются специальные алгоритмы и механизмы, которые распределяют ресурсы между различными задачами и программами. Это позволяет избежать конфликтов и обеспечить оптимальную производительность.
Таким образом, компьютерная система функционирует благодаря четко организованной последовательности действий и взаимодействию различных компонентов. Это обеспечивает высокую эффективность и надежность работы всей системы.